Olio Nuovo: The Most Anticipated Extra Virgin Olive Oil of the Year
Dec 13, 2017
This ultra-fresh olive oil is a seasonal treat meant to be enjoyed within a few months of purchase. Use it to dress a bed of mixed greens, serve it alongside a cheese board with warm bread, or serve it on a Christmas roast of top-quality beef tenderloin or leg of lamb.
